How to set up social media for a business?
To set up social media for a business, start by identifying your target audience and selecting the right platforms. Each platform has its unique audience and features, so choose those that align with your business goals. Here are the steps to follow:
-
Define Your Goals: Determine what you want to achieve with social media, such as brand awareness, customer engagement, or sales.
-
Choose the Right Platforms: Select platforms based on where your audience spends their time. Common options include:
- Facebook: Great for community building and advertising.
- Instagram: Ideal for visual content and younger demographics.
- LinkedIn: Best for B2B networking and professional content.
- Twitter: Useful for real-time updates and customer service.
-
Create Business Profiles: Set up accounts using your business name, logo, and relevant information. Ensure consistency in branding across all platforms.
-
Develop a Content Strategy: Plan what type of content you will share, such as promotional posts, educational content, or user-generated material. Use a content calendar to stay organized.
-
Engage with Your Audience: Respond to comments and messages promptly. Engagement helps build relationships and trust with your audience.
-
Analyze and Adjust: Use analytics tools provided by the platforms to track performance. Adjust your strategy based on what works best for your audience.
